Meet Bea DuBois: Girls Inc. of Greater Indianapolis Q2 2026 Employee of the Quarter

At Girls Inc. of Greater Indianapolis, our mission to inspire girls to be strong, smart, and bold comes to life through the passion and dedication of our team. Each quarter, we recognize a staff member who exemplifies our core values and makes a meaningful impact across our organization and community.

We are proud to celebrate Bea DuBois, Office Manager, as our Q2 2026 Employee of the Quarter, recognized for embodying the value of Innovation.

Bea DuBois, Office Manager

Value Award: Innovation

As Office Manager, Bea DuBois is known for finding thoughtful, efficient ways to improve processes and support those around her. Whether she’s streamlining workflows, solving challenges, or helping teammates navigate day-to-day operations, Bea approaches every task with creativity, collaboration, and a commitment to continuous improvement.

Bea shares what being innovative means to her and how it has shaped her career:

“Being innovative has been a great skill I have grown through my career. I enjoy working through different variables, testing, and adjusting as necessary to create the best processes for accomplishing tasks and successful outcomes. Brainstorming, being able to understand goals, collaborate, and learn, drive me to support others but not limit myself,” she says.
